Splash Beverage Group Inc. (SBEV) reported a second-quarter 2025 net loss of $4.47 per share, significantly wider than the analyst consensus estimate of a loss of $3.264 per share—a negative surprise of 36.95%. Revenue figures were not disclosed for the quarter. The stock declined 4.07% in the following trading session as investors reacted to the larger-than-anticipated loss.

During the second quarter of 2025, management attributed the deeper loss to elevated operating expenses and ongoing investments in brand development and distribution expansion. The company continued to scale its portfolio of beverage brands, including ready-to-drink cocktails and functional beverages, while working to improve supply chain efficiencies. Despite the EPS shortfall, management highlighted progress in securing new retail listings and expanding into additional geographic markets. Gross margin trends were not explicitly detailed, but the higher loss suggests persistent cost pressures from raw materials, logistics, and promotional spending. Segment performance was not broken out, as the company operates as a single reporting unit with multiple brands. Management emphasized that the quarter’s results reflect a transitional period as the company invests in long-term growth infrastructure, including sales personnel and marketing campaigns designed to drive brand awareness and velocity at retail. Looking ahead, the company expects to continue prioritizing revenue growth and market share gains, though it acknowledges that near-term profitability may remain elusive. Management has not provided specific guidance for the remainder of FY2025, but noted that cost-control initiatives and operational efficiencies are being evaluated. Strategic priorities include accelerating distribution wins, optimizing the product mix toward higher-margin offerings, and pursuing additional capital to support working capital needs. Risk factors include the highly competitive beverage landscape, potential supply chain disruptions, and the need for additional financing to sustain operations. The management team expressed confidence that the current investments will position the company for improved financial performance in later periods, but cautioned that the timing and magnitude of any turnaround remain uncertain. The company may also explore asset monetization or licensing agreements to generate non-dilutive funding. The market’s response to the Q2 earnings miss was negative, with the stock declining 4.07% on the day following the release. Analysts covering SBEV have expressed caution, noting that the EPS shortfall raises questions about the company’s path to breakeven and the sustainability of its cash burn rate. Some analysts have adjusted their models to reflect higher operating losses, while others await clearer signs of revenue acceleration before revising their outlook. Investment implications center on whether the company’s brand-building investments will eventually translate into scalable, profitable revenue. Key items to watch in coming quarters include the pace of new distribution additions, gross margin trends, and any announcements regarding capital raises or strategic partnerships. The broader market context for small-cap beverage companies remains challenging, with investors favoring firms that demonstrate a clear path to positive cash flow.
